What are the different types of movements exhibited by the cells of human body?

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

Cells of human body show types of movements:
(i) Amoeboid movements. These are shown by leucocytes (especially neutrophils) of blood, macrophages of connective tissue and phagocytes of certain body organs e.g., Kupffer cells of liver. Such movements are brought with the help of temporary feet, called pseudopodia formed by the streaming movement of of cytoplasm, called cyclosis, and cytoskeleton structures called microfilaments.
(ii) Ciliary movements. A number of internal structures of man like trachea, fallopian tubes and vasa efferentia are lined by ciliated epithelium. The cells have fine hair-like cilia arising from the cytoplasmic basal granules. The cilia beat in coordination and move dust particles out of trachea, egg or zygote in the fallopian tube and sperms in vasa efferentia.
(iii) Muscular movements. These are brought about by the specific types of muscle fibres. These include the movements of eye balls, pinnae of ears, peristalsis of gut, heard beating, chest movements, etc. for photoreception, sound (phono-) reception, food movements, transportation of materials, respiration respectively.
